The reason people go with OBD0 so to get rid of the Emissions headache. But you dont get a knock sensor though.
The 91 ECU isnt going to accomodate VTEC for you. You will need at least a 93 if I remember right.
You can run pretty much whatever ECU you want as long as it has the code for VTEC on it. P28's are pretty much the standard that everyone wants to use. You can easily chip them and run whatever ROM you want.
Or to avoid a lot of headache get a 1st Gen GSR ECU and convert your harness for OBD1. I beleive they were 93-95 models. Cant remeber exactly.

I can convert a 88-91 PM6 (civ/crx Si) to have vtec out for you.. You'd have to tune it yourself though, or get someone to do it for you. I don't have maps for that engine for the PM6. You'll have to get a P28 chipped if you decide to go with a P28 instead, the stock D16Z6 program isn't the best for LSVTEC use either.
